Obverse description Armored bust of Prince Honoré II facing right, depicted in cuirass and wearing the cordon of the Order of the Holy Spirit draped across the chest. The effigy is rendered in the Baroque style typical of mid-17th century hammered coinage. A circular Latin legend surrounds the portrait within the coin's field, with the ruler's titles abbreviated in the customary manner of the period.
